Hello I'm tryuing to learn to use libpq but it is quite difficult when you are unable to compile programs as I am ;-) I get this error when I compile the program in the buttom of this message: /usr/local/pgsql/lib/libpq.so: undefined reference to `crypt' I use this command on my Red Hat Linux 5.2 system when i try to compile: gcc -I/usr/local/pgsql/include -o lj lj.c -L/usr/local/pgsql/lib -lpq My program looks like this: (it was included in an article in Linux Journal) #include <libpq-fe.h> #include <strings.h> int main(int argc, char** argv) { PGconn* conn; PGresult* result; int i; char* dbname = "tutorial"; conn = PQsetdb (NULL, NULL, NULL, NULL, dbname); if(PQstatus(conn) == CONNECTION_BAD) { fprintf(stderr, "Connection to database '%S' failed.\n", dbname); fprintf(stderr,"%S", PQerrorMessage(conn)); PQfinish(conn); exit(1); } result = PQexec(conn, "select * from cities");if ((!result) || (PGRES_TUPLES_OK != PQresultStatus(result))) { fprintf(stderr, "Error sending query.\nDetailed report: %s\n", PQerrorMessage(conn)); PQfinish(conn); exit(1); } printf("name\t\tpopulation\taltitude\n\n");for (i = PQntuples(result)-1; i >= 0; i--) { printf("%s\t%s\t\t%s\n", PQgetvalue(result,i,0), PQgetvalue(result,i,1), PQgetvalue(result,i,2)); } } -- Med venlig hilsen Martin Sk�tt mskott@image.dk
